The U. S. government agreed to construct the lighthouse at Grosse Point after several maritime disasters, including the sinking of the Lady Elgin, showed need for it. The Italianate building was designed by General Orlando Metcalf Poe, Chief Engineer of this lighthouse district, who designed and oversaw construction of eight "Poe style lighthouses" along the Great Lakes.
